Seniors Kelton Boster and Kamryn Nolan were crowned king and queen at the 2021 fall homecoming.

October 5, 2021 By Kasey McDowell


The Mulvane High School fall homecoming festivities have come and gone and what a week it was. The schools participated in the themes for spirit week and topped off with a half-day pep assembly at the football stadium. During halftime of the football game versus Coffeyville, the homecoming ceremony commenced and the king and queen were announced.

The 2021 Mulvane High School Homecoming Queen is Miss Kamryn Nolan and the King is Mr. Kelton Boster. Kamryn is the daughter of Chris and Kari Nolan. As a student at MHS, Kamryn has been involved in student council, FFA, NHS, SADD, cross country, basketball, and soccer. Kelton is the son of Ryan Boster and Theresa Cummins. Kelton’s activities include soccer, basketball, baseball, wrestling, band, drumline, student council, national honor society, and forensics.

The homecoming court consisted of Miss Malena Heck, Miss Bella Larraga, Miss Cierra Milledge, Mr. Victor Salazar, Mr. Keaton Herd, and Mr. Ian Comer. The attendants were Emma Headrick and Koen Kline. The Wildcats won the game in fine fashion 51-6.
